Located in Kanchanbagh, Hyderabad, it is involved in the development of computing solutions for numerical analysis and their use in other DRDO projects.
Later in 1991, ANURAG became a part of defense R&D Organization.support aeronautical design work,[1] with the mandate of executing specific, time-bound projects leading to the development of custom designed computing systems and software packages for numerical analysis and other applications.
Much of this research is conducted in state-of-the-art concepts like parallel architectures, etc., in order to build up a technology base in these areas.
Its areas of work are:[4] PACE (Processor for Aerodynamic Computations and Evaluation),[1][5] developed by ANURAG, is a loosely coupled, message-passing parallel processing supercomputer.
It can also be used for other fields such as weather forecasting, automobile & civil engineering design, and Molecular Biology.
These systems have been built using VME-bus based Pentium processor boards, ATM switches, and Reflective Memory communication hardware.
At present work is in progress on a parallel processing system based on Linux clusters targeted to deliver 1 teraflop performance.
